Overview We are seeking an SAP Data & Analytics Consultant to support a large-scale ERP modernization initiative within a highly regulated federal environment. This role focuses on delivering data-driven solutions by designing, developing, and maintaining analytics and reporting capabilities within an SAP S/4HANA landscape.
The consultant will play a key role in transforming enterprise data into actionable insights using SAP Analytics Cloud (SAC), embedded analytics, and data integration tools to support planning, reporting, and operational decision‑making.
This is a 75% remote position with approximately 25% quarterly travel to the Washington, DC metro area .
Per our Federal Government Contract, candidates must be U.S. Citizens with an Active Secret Clearance .
Responsibilities
Design and develop analytics and reporting solutions using SAP Analytics Cloud (SAC), including dashboards, stories, and predictive models
Build and maintain data models and key performance indicators (KPIs) to support financial, operational, and business reporting
Collaborate with functional teams to translate business requirements into intuitive dashboards and real‑time reporting solutions
Support planning and budgeting processes by configuring SAC planning models and integrating with SAP S/4HANA
Execute data integration and transformation activities using ETL tools (e.g., SAP Data Services or similar)
Support data validation, reconciliation, and migration efforts as part of broader system transformation initiatives
Maintain documentation of data models, transformation logic, and reporting structures to support audit and compliance requirements
Participate in Agile project delivery, supporting sprint planning, task execution, and timeline adherence
Troubleshoot data and reporting issues, ensuring accuracy and consistency across analytics platforms
Qualifications
U.S. Citizenship required with an Active Secret Clearance or higher
3–7 years of experience in SAP Data & Analytics, including SAP Analytics Cloud (SAC) and/or SAP BW/4HANA
Hands‑on experience with data modeling, reporting, and dashboard development
Experience with ETL and data integration tools (e.g., SAP Data Services, Syniti, or similar)
Understanding of SAP S/4HANA data structures and core business processes (e.g., finance, procurement)
Experience supporting data migration or transformation initiatives within SAP environments
Strong analytical and problem‑solving skills with attention to data accuracy and integrity
Ability to communicate technical concepts clearly to both technical and non‑technical stakeholders
Experience in a federal or highly regulated environment preferred
Familiarity with data compliance and reporting standards is a plus
Bachelor’s degree or equivalent experience preferred
Pay and Benefits
W2 Hourly rate starts at $50. Pay rates are based on experience and qualifications, and are subject to change at any time.
Benefits may include paid time off (PTO), medical, dental, and vision coverage, life insurance, long‑term disability insurance, a 401(k) plan, and additional optional benefits.
